My primary goal was to increase revenue by increasing ticket and food sales and grow the customer base while keeping prior customers
INCREASING ONLINE TICKET SALES
To increase online ticket sales I redesigned the website with this goal in mind. Through simplifying the process to redirect customers to the buy tickets page and displaying information in easier to comprehend formats, online ticket sales increased by over 60%.
INCREASING FOOD SALES
I started a texting program that gives customers one free popcorn if they spend $25 at the concession stand and sign up to receive weekly text alerts. Overall the program resulted in increased spending of 36% for each concession transaction. The text alerts program has over 6,000 customers signed up today.
To increase food sales I created an advertisement which is played before the movie starts that showcases the vast majority of the concession menu. Additionally, I recently started a program that gives customers a free popcorn if they spend $20 at the concession stand and have signed up for our texting list. Due to this implementation the average concession transaction increased by $0.39.

ACQUIRING AND RETAINING CUSTOMERS
To acquire and retain new customers I answered thousands of questions and inquiries through Facebook Messenger. Since January 2020 I read and processed messages from over 4,00 people. Additionally to reengage customers I designed and ran several promotions such as give-aways, photo contests, and partnering with local companies to offer unique experiences.
Socially, to continually engage and grow the customer base I posted on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, and created a texting program that has over 6,000 customers.
